  • It is not possible to find a real champion in a weight class these days when there are so many championship belts and so many undefeated boxers.
    There are 3 or 4 champions in each weight class. We don't know who is better or more talented because they don't face each other.
    This is a real problem. It was in heavyweight a year ago and cruiserweight 6 years ago. It is tangled like a cat's ball and it is getting harder to solve every day.
    There is only one solution to the problem. One person needs to come out and collect all the belts. This is not possible because boxers do not accept every match. They make money with easier matches.
    A man solved this problem in cruiserweight 6 years ago. After clearing all the weight classes, that man gained weight and rose to the giants. He solved the problem by breaking the giants. He did not act spoiled, he pushed himself every day and beat the best to reach the best.
    The name of the boxer who was born on the same day as Muhammad Ali is Oleksandr Usyk. He sees boxing as just a job. He does not disrespect his opponents. He constantly seeks competition and wants the best. Usyk is the best boxer of our time with his smiling face outside the ring and his scary looks inside the ring.     One of Usyk’s many talents is being able to almost instantly (1 or 2 rounds) understand the rhythm of his opponent’s offence / defence and adapt his own offence / defence in a way that finds the holes in both. People may see Usyk’s upper body and head movement, and think it’s a bit robotic, but when a fighter’s offence / defence is rehearsed rather than adapted, you see what happened to Jared Anderson against Bakole. Anderson looked slick against bums, but you saw against an elite opponent, that movement was generic, and he got bounced round the ring. Usyk has decoded every single opponent he has ever faced as a professional. The guy is a genius, along with having quite ridiculous stamina and fitness that enables him to fight at an extremely high pace rds1-6, and then go up another gear 7-12 while his opponent is exhausted. Add an impenetrable belief and faith in his ability to win, and you have an all time great.
